This book presents a synthesis of ideas from CriticalTheory, Postcolonialism, and Poststructuralism. Through the application of negative dialectics, issues in Indo-American cultural assimilation(primarily post-1965 immigration to the UnitedStates) are explored. Hybridity, and the multiplemanifestations of selves and subjectivity, areanalyzed through the lens of Foucault''s notion ofbiopower and Nietzsche''s critiques of Christianity. Issues of ''bad faith'' and ''false consciousness'' arelinked to race, class, gender, sexuality, nation, andreligion. Ultimately, philosophical concepts areamplified by site-specific ethnographic researchconducted amongst Indian and Indo-American men andwomen. The book is, simultaneously, a critique and anaffirmation of ideas such as ''Model Minority'' and''The American Dream.''
